The National Football League was recently shaken by a monumental trade, as the Dallas Cowboys opted to part ways with superstar linebacker Micah Parsons, sending him to the Green Bay Packers. This high-stakes transaction has undeniably sent shockwaves throughout the league, altering the defensive landscape for both franchises and sparking intense debate among analysts and fans alike regarding the future of the Dallas Cowboys defense and the impact of the Micah Parsons Trade.

In a move that signaled a significant strategic shift, the Dallas Cowboys secured two valuable first-round draft picks in 2026 and 2027, alongside seasoned defensive tackle Kenny Clark, from the Green Bay Packers. This blockbuster deal sees the Cowboys bolstering their future draft capital while immediately acquiring a proven talent to anchor their defensive line, a critical component for any Super Bowl contender aiming for immediate impact in the NFL News.

The financial implications of this trade for Micah Parsons are equally staggering, with the star defensive player reportedly signing a record-breaking contract with the Green Bay Packers. This new deal includes an astonishing $62 million in the first year alone, with $120 million fully guaranteed and a total of $136 million guaranteed, setting unprecedented benchmarks for a non-quarterback in NFL history and underscoring his elite status.

Dallas Cowboys fans must now quickly familiarize themselves with Kenny Clark, the formidable defensive tackle joining their ranks. Clark, who spent his entire career with the Green Bay Packers, brings a wealth of experience and a powerful presence to the interior defensive line, promising to be an integral part of the team’s defensive strategy as the new NFL season approaches. His addition is expected to immediately impact the run defense and pass rush for the Dallas Cowboys.

Clark’s history includes a notable playoff encounter against the Cowboys during his rookie season in 2016, where his Green Bay Packers emerged victorious in a thrilling 34-31 NFC Divisional game at AT&T Stadium. This previous experience against his new team adds an interesting narrative layer to his arrival, showcasing his big-game pedigree and familiarity with the high-stakes environment of NFL postseason play, making him a compelling figure in the latest NFL Trades.

Before the surprising Micah Parsons trade, Kenny Clark had openly expressed his fervent desire for a Super Bowl championship with the Green Bay Packers, emphasizing a sense of urgency. He vocalized frustrations over past divisional performance, stating, “We just don’t got no more time to waste,” a sentiment that now aligns perfectly with the Dallas Cowboys’ own championship aspirations and “win-now” mentality.
